  • <jats:sec><jats:title>Background</jats:title><jats:p> The SVV tests the ability of a person to perceive the gravitational vertical. A tilt in SVV indicates vestibular imbalance in the roll plane, and thus injuries to the utricle or its connecting nerves. A validated bedside method (et, al., 2009, 72(19):1689–1692, Neurol, Zwergal) is the bucket method, in which the subject estimates the true vertical by attempting to properly align a straight line visible on the bottom of a bucket that is rotated at random by the examiner. In our study, the subjects need to align the plumb line on the Visual Vertical iOS app to the vertical direction. </jats:p></jats:sec><jats:sec><jats:title>Methods</jats:title><jats:p> Measurements of the SVV were made in 22 healthy subjects (16 females and 6 males). Each subject conducted 10 iterations of bucket test and 10 iterations of iOS app test. The reliability and validity of the iOS app was analyzed by SPSS21. </jats:p></jats:sec><jats:sec><jats:title>Results</jats:title><jats:p> Cronbach's α for the plumb line method was 0.976, and the iOS app was 0.978. Statistical comparison of SVV values measured by the iOS app and the bucket method showed no significant difference in distribution (Mann Whitney U test U = 0.944). </jats:p></jats:sec><jats:sec><jats:title>Conclusion</jats:title><jats:p> The Visual Vertical iOS app is an effective and accessible substitute to the plumb line for the measurement of the validated bucket test. </jats:p></jats:sec>
